Funding a biotech company requires delicate consideration due to an escalating requirement for time and money alike, like the finding of the appropriate funds. Irrespective of the startups’ size and the drugs they develop, a primary cycle before the drug’s establishment in the market generally accounts for 10-15 years with an average cost range of 2.5 billion USD. Similarly, medical devices undergo a certain observation period before their promotion of around 31 months, ranging up to 31 million USD for class II devices with 510(k). A class III device normally comes into effect post 54 months of FDA(Food and Drug Administration) discussions with an investment of 94 million USD on average.

Organic growth funding is a customary approach for non-FDA products owing to its research tools, which can be flexible for academia or people in the research industry. Relying on this strategy can yield promising results for both customers and their respective margins, thus enabling them to retain the solemn power of the startup. However, threats of limitations in its availability and risks to capital persist in the approach and deter the expansion of sales.
Meanwhile, equity investments enable trading ownership of the startup with investors in return for money. By ensuring that the stake is reliable for shareholders, the strategy is put into the process through enhanced sales skills and realistic business plans. Generally, the approach encompasses two varied types of speculation, like venture capital firms and angel investors. While the former gathers money from wealthy individuals and financial institutions for a larger fund accumulation, the latter forms various groups to streamline their due diligence and thus make it more efficient.
Awards concerning biotech businesses are abundant where SBIR and STTR(Small Business Technology Transfer) hold crucial importance. The services offered by these grants differ from the existing policies as startups apply for funding and are approved instead of finding sources that could render endowment. Furthermore, companies with abundant resources and funds and are often unable to innovate should turn to corporate partnerships for assistance. Ensuring that a robust connection exists between the companies facilitates the success of the strategy, where armouring both businesses’ intellectual property (IP) plays a critical role.
